NOTICE: Using a single pipe vent in cold climates puts
the water heater at risk of freezing, as negative air
pressure is common in buildings during cold weather.
This situation will pull cold air through the heat
exchanger and can lead to damage and a water leak.
Freeze damage to the water heater is not covered under
warranty.
